The first step in any skincare regimen is cleansing. Throughout the day, your skin collects dirt, oil, sweat, and makeup, all of which https://playfulpalmscasino.co.uk can clog pores and lead to breakouts if left untreated. Cleansing helps remove these impurities, ensuring that your skin stays fresh and clean. It’s important to choose a cleanser that matches your skin type. For dry skin, opt for a gentle, hydrating cleanser that won’t strip away natural oils. Those with oily or acne-prone skin should select a gel-based or foaming cleanser, which will help control excess oil. Cleansing your skin twice a day—once in the morning and once before bed—helps maintain a balanced and clear complexion.

After cleansing, moisturizing is the next crucial step. Even if your skin is oily, moisturizing is essential for maintaining proper hydration. For dry skin, look for a richer cream or oil-based moisturizer that will provide long-lasting hydration. For oily or combination skin, opt for a lightweight, oil-free moisturizer. Moisturizing helps prevent the skin from becoming too dry, flaky, or irritated. It also helps keep the skin’s moisture barrier intact, which is essential for protecting against environmental factors.

One of the most important aspects of skin care is sun protection. The sun’s ultraviolet (UV) rays can cause premature aging, wrinkles, and even skin cancer over time. Wearing sunscreen daily is a must, even on cloudy days or when staying indoors, as UV rays can penetrate windows. Ap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her to all exposed skin. Reapply every two hours if you’re outdoors for extended periods. Sunscreen not only protects the skin but also helps maintain its youthful appearance by preventing sunspots and wrinkles.

Exfoliating regularly is another important step in achieving clear and smooth skin. Exfoliation removes dead skin cells from the surface, revealing fresh skin underneath. This helps to unclog pores and promote a more even skin tone. However, it’s important not to over-exfoliate, as doing so can irritate the skin. Once or twice a week is usually sufficient for most skin types.

The process of web development can be divided into two main areas: front-end and back-end development. Front-end development focuses on the design and functionality of the user interface. This is what users interact with when https://rubycasinos.co.uk they visit a website. It includes everything from the layout and typography to the navigation and interactive elements. Front-end developers use H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to create visually appealing and responsive websites that work well on various devices, from desktops to mobile phones.

On the other hand, back-end development deals with the server-side of web development. This is where the functionality of a website or web application is powered. Back-end developers work with databases, servers, and applications to ensure that the website’s features work as intended. They often use programming languages like PHP, Ruby, Python, and Java to build the infrastructure that supports a website’s front-end. The back-end is crucial for storing and retrieving data, handling user interactions, and ensuring the site runs efficiently.

In addition to front-end and back-end development, there has been a rise in full-stack development, which combines both front-end and back-end skills. Full-stack developers are equipped to handle all aspects of web development, making them highly valuable to companies looking for versatile professionals who can build and maintain entire web applications.

Another important aspect of modern web development is the use of frameworks and content management systems (CMS). Frameworks like React, Angular, and Vue.js have simplified front-end development, allowing developers to build fast, scalable, and interactive user interfaces. Similarly, CMS platforms such as WordPress and Joomla make it easier for individuals and businesses to create and manage websites without needing to write code from scratch. These tools have lowered the barrier to entry for web development, enabling even non-technical users to create professional websites.
